製造スケジュールと最適化 (MSO) ソリューションのシミュレーション シナリオは、製造会社が what-if シナリオ検査を実行し、実際の生産シナリオとさまざまなシミュレーション シナリオを比較して、さまざまなインフラストラクチャ スケジュールの利点と欠点を理解するのに役立ちます。
MSOシミュレーションシナリオの主なユーザーは、製造計画担当者と生産活動イベント管理者です。シミュレーション シナリオ検査の後、最も生産性の高いインフラストラクチャに基づいて必要なビジネス上の決定を下し、実際の制約/資源と比較して作業現場のボトルネックを把握することで、必要な変更を行うことができます。最終的に、製造施設のすべての関係者は、MSO のシミュレーション シナリオに基づいて作成された変更された作業現場の状況で、生産性と実現可能性の向上というメリットを得ることができます。
作業者クラス従業員 (生産管理者、機械オペレーターなど) も、管理可能な作業負荷を備えた完全にバランスのとれた作業環境という間接的なメリットを享受する一方、製造施設の消費者は、製造会社を使用する IFS MSO から時間どおりのオーダー履行のメリットを享受します。
シミュレーション シナリオ分析ページで提供される統計分析または比較は、ユーザーがさまざまな KPI (主要業績評価指標) に基づいて生産シナリオとシミュレーション シナリオを比較するのに役立ちます。
図1 - MSO シミュレーション シナリオ
重要:同じサイトで新しいシミュレーションシナリオを作成するには、そのサイトに 「有限スケジュール基本情報」 のレコードが必須です。ただし、生産サイトのデータセットを有効化したり、ベース サイトの有限スケジュールを作成したりすることは必須ではありません。シミュレーションシナリオのすべてのスケジューリングルールと最適化目標は、 「有限スケジュール基本情報」 ページに設定された生産サイトの設定に基づいて決定されます。
シミュレーション シナリオページから、MSO ユーザーは新しいシミュレーション シナリオを作成し、サイトのシミュレートされた有限スケジュールを受け取ることができます。これらの側面は、生産サイトだけでなくベース生産サイトのシミュレーション シナリオでもビジネス固有のパラメーターであるため、ユーザーは同じスケジューリング ルールと目標を使用することが予想されます。したがって、 「有限スケジュール基本情報」に示される工程ブロックや段取マトリックスなどのルールや目標は、同じサイトのすべてのシミュレーションシナリオに適用されます。
デフォルトでは、最小受け入れ品質管理とスケジュールされた待機時間の生成はベース サイトに応じて設定されますが、ユーザーはデータセット パラメータ グループで指定された列を使用して、シミュレーション シナリオごとにこれを変更できます。シミュレーション データセット ID とシミュレーション シナリオのスケジュール済日付と時刻も、データセット パラメータ グループに表示されます。
MSO シミュレーション シナリオ機能は、既存の実際の (ベース) 生産スケジュールのさまざまなバリエーションを取得するのに役立ちます。
これは、既存の制約や資源のスケジューリング パラメータを修正したり、
既存の制約や資源を含めたり除外したり、
あるいは制約や資源を追加したりすることで実現されます。
ユーザーは ワークセンタ資源タブでサイトの既存のワークセンタ資源の一覧を取得できます。
その後、ユーザーは、必要な仮想の新しい資源を既存のワークセンタまたは仮想の新しいワークセンタに追加できます。
既存タイプまたは追加タイプの資源の有効期間の変更/追加 (例:開始日と終了日)
既存 の資源または 追加した 資源のカレンダーを変更します。(サイト上で勤務時間カレンダを既に利用している場合に限ります)
有限山積を無限山積に、または無限山積を有限山積に変更します
ユーザーは、 個人タブでサイトの既存の作業者クラス個人の一覧を取得できます。
その後、ユーザーは、希望する仮想的な新規人員を既存の作業者クラスまたは仮想的な新規作業者クラスに追加できます。
既存タイプまたは追加タイプの個人の有効期間の変更/追加 (例:開始日と終了日)
既存タイプまたは追加タイプの個人のカレンダを変更します。(サイト上ですでに勤務時間カレンダを利用している場合に限ります。個人を使用している人事スケジュールは変更されません。)
有限山積を無限山積に、または無限山積を有限山積に変更します
ユーザーは、 作業者クラスグループ タブでサイトの既存の作業者クラス個人グループの一覧を取得できます。
その後、ユーザーは、希望する仮想の新しい人員グループを既存の作業者クラスまたは仮想の新しい作業者クラスに追加できます。
既存タイプまたは追加タイプの個人グループの有効期間の変更/追加 (例:開始日と終了日)
既存タイプまたは追加タイプの個人グループのカレンダを変更します。(サイト上で勤務時間カレンダを既に利用している場合に限ります)
有限山積を無限山積に、または無限山積を有限山積に変更します
ユーザーは、 個人グループタブでサイトの既存の製造ツールのリストを取得します。
その後、ユーザーは、必要な仮想の新しいツール インスタンスを既存のツールまたは仮想の新しいツールに追加できます。
既存タイプまたは追加タイプのツールの有効期間の変更/追加 (例:開始日と終了日)
既存タイプまたは追加タイプのツールのカレンダを変更します。(サイト上で勤務時間カレンダを既に利用している場合に限ります)
有限山積を無限山積に、または無限山積を有限山積に変更します
注釈:[計画済]、[リリース済]、[引当済]、または [製造 Started] タイプの製造オーダー接続を持つ資源/制約のみがシミュレーション シナリオにリストされます。生産では使用されていないが、シナリオで考慮する必要があるその他のすべての資源または制約は、新しい資源または制約として手動で追加できます。
2.ヘッダにある「すべての変更をリセットする」コマンドを使用すると、既存の資源や制約に対して行った変更を元に戻すことができます。ただし、新しく 追加された 資源や制約は削除されません。
3.シミュレーション シナリオで仮想的な状況を作成した後、ユーザーはデータセットのアクティブ化コマンドを使用してデータセットをアクティブ化できます。アクティブ化後、データセットを有効化したユーザーを考慮してシナリオ所有者が設定されます。このユーザーのみが、 有限スケジュール基本情報 ページと同様に、特定のデータセットを編集または削除できる権限を持ちます。
4.次に、スケジュールシナリオコマンドを使用して、MSO スケジューリング サービスにスケジュール作成要求を行うことができます。その後、ヘッダ グループの「スケジュールなし」バッジが消え、最新スケジュール開始時刻列が表示されます。この列には、シミュレーション シナリオが実際に開始した日時が表示され、さらに生産サイト設定の有限スケジュール基本情報 ページで指定された スケジュール開始時刻 (時間) も考慮されます。
5.シミュレーション シナリオのスケジュール設定後、データセット パラメータ グループの予定日時列が、スケジュール サービスからのスケジュール受信時刻で更新されます。この日時が 予定日時列に更新された後、ユーザーは シミュレーション シナリオ分析ページおよびシミュレーション資源割当ページで結果を確認し、分析できるようになります。
シミュレーション シナリオ分析ページを使用すると、基本生産シナリオとさまざまな仮想シナリオを比較および分析したり、スケジュールのさまざまな主要業績評価指標 (KPIs) を考慮してさまざまな仮想シナリオを比較したりできます。
シミュレーション資源割当の概要ページは、MSO シミュレーション シナリオによって行われた資源割当のリストを表示します。このページでは、シミュレーション番号、説明、シナリオ実行日、シナリオ所有者の基準に基づいて結果を検索およびフィルタリングできます。